Alam Sarowar Tito, Kishoreganj :
The President Abdul Hamid visited the two days official visit flood affected haor areas in Kishoreganj and Sunamgonj.
After his arrival at Mithamoin upazila headquarters at Sunday noon, the president flew in a sea helicopter to the Haor areas of the district that have been ravaged by flash flood recently triggering food crisis.
Days of heavy rainfall and onrush of water from the upstream Maghalaya hills in India caused the flash flood that have damaged around 42,000 hectares of paddy fields, mostly of mature Boro rice, in Mithamoin, Austogram, Itna, Nikli and Bajitpur upazilas of district, according to the Department of Agricultural Extension (DAE).
Huge extent of paddy fields in the Haor areas of neighbouring Sunamganj, Sylhet, Habiganj, Moulvibazar, Netrakona and Brahmanbaria districts have also been affected by the flood.
An exchange view meeting with haor peoples held at Mithamoin upazila auditorium on Sunday evening with local MP Rezwan Ahmed Toufic in the chair.
It was addressed among others by State Minister for Finance M.A Mannan, Mithamoin Upazila Chairman Advocate Shahidul Islam, Principal Abdul Hoque, Asia Begum, and Union Parished Chairman Sharif Kamal.
State Minister for Finance and Planning M.A Mannan said on April 9 that the government would take steps to provide relief to the affected people, after visiting the flood-affected areas in Sunamganj.
He observed that many farmers in Haor areas were facing food scarcity due to recent flash flood and stated that he would advocate for exempting the affected farmers from loan repayment.
Rezwan Ahmed Toufic MP had demanded that the flood-affected Haor areas be declared disaster zone to tackle the situation.
